引言随着互联网的普及,动画已经成为了一种非常受欢迎的媒体形式。SWF(Small Web Format)动画因其跨平台性和丰富的交互性,在网页设计和游戏开发中得到了广泛的应用。C语言作为一种高效、灵活...
随着互联网的普及,动画已经成为了一种非常受欢迎的媒体形式。SWF(Small Web Format)动画因其跨平台性和丰富的交互性,在网页设计和游戏开发中得到了广泛的应用。C语言作为一种高效、灵活的编程语言,虽然通常与系统编程和嵌入式开发联系在一起,但其实它也可以用来创建SWF动画。本文将详细介绍如何使用C语言轻松打造个性SWF动画,即使是编程新手也能轻松上手。
SWF是一种由Adobe Systems开发的矢量图形和动画格式,常用于网页上的多媒体内容。SWF动画具有以下特点:
C语言是一种广泛使用的计算机编程语言,以其高效、灵活和可移植性而闻名。C语言的特点包括:
以下是一个简单的C语言示例,演示如何使用SWFlib库创建一个简单的SWF动画:
#include
int main() { SWFMovie* movie = SWF_NewMovie(50, 50); SWFShape* shape = SWF_NewShape(movie); // 绘制一个圆形 SWFNewCommand(shape, CMD_SETLINESTYLE, 1, 2, 0, 0, 0, 1); SWFNewCommand(shape, CMD_CIRCLE, 25, 25, 20); // 添加到电影中 SWFAddShape(movie, shape); // 保存SWF文件 SWF_SaveMovie(movie, "example.swf"); SWF_DeleteMovie(movie); return 0;
} 使用C语言创建SWF动画虽然相对复杂,但通过学习和实践,即使是编程新手也能轻松掌握。本文介绍了SWF动画和C语言的基本知识,以及使用C语言创建SWF动画的步骤和实用技巧。希望本文能帮助你开启SWF动画创作之旅。